What they do
A Dental Assistant assists dentists in caring for patient's teeth. Helps patients get ready for treatment; prepares equipment and supplies. May perform some dental procedures under the direction of a dentist, such as fluoride application, if allowed under state regulations. Works in dental offices.

JOB SUMMARY
Assists in preventive, therapeutic, cosmetic and other dental services with occasional guidance by a board certified dentist. .KEY RESPONSIBILITIES
- Performs dental assistant duties.
- Prepares patient for procedure and/or exam.
- Provides patient with instructions.
- Maintenance and cleaning of equipment.
- The responsibilities listed are a general overview of the position and additional duties may be assigned.
TECHNICAL CAPABILITIES
- Patient Exam Room Care (Novice): Possesses sufficient fundamental proficiency to successfully demonstrate patient exam room care in practical applications of moderate difficulty.
- Dental Terminology (Novice): Possesses sufficient fundamental proficiency to successfully demonstrate dental terminology in practical applications of moderate difficulty.
- Sterilization Preparation (Novice): Possesses sufficient fundamental proficiency to successfully demonstrate sterilization preparation in practical applications of moderate difficulty. Generally works under the direction of others while accomplishing assignments.
- Patient Documentation (Novice): Possesses sufficient fundamental proficiency to successfully demonstrate patient documentation in practical applications of moderate difficulty.
